Thyra “Lee” Parker was born October 10, 1922 to Everett andlva Adams Ray in Murray, Kentucky. Died January 13, 2015 in Springfield, Mo. The family moved in 1935 to St. Louis, MO where Lee graduated from McKinley High School and Hadley Business School. She married her childhood sweetheart, William A. Parker, youngest son of James Thomas and Nora
Mae Parker also of Murray, Kentucky on June 9, 1944. They have a daughter, Carole Jean. She and her husband, Joseph Bradley, reside in Springfield, MO. Lee has 3 grandsons. Blake and Emily Bradley of Springfield, Mo, Brent Bradley of Springfield, Brian and Heather Bradley of Wichita, KS. Two great grandchildren Cameron and Makenzie of Wichita, KS. Lee is also survived by her sister, Diane Arteaga and husband, Ernie of New Melle, MO. Two nephews, Dr. Keith Kenter and wife Patty and their children, Madeline, Charlotte and Mitchel of Loveland, OH. Kelly Kenter and his children Kade, London and Hudson of St. Louis. Both Lee and her husband accepted the Lord in their teens and were Sunday School teachers at Overland Baptist Church. Lee worked at Travelers Protective Association 34 years. Her husband served his country in the US Army during WWII in Central Europe and retired after 26 years from Jackes-Evans Manufacturing in St. Louis. They moved to Springfield, Mo 15 years ago and were members of Second Baptist Church.
